Unlock Passive Income: Best Dividend Stocks for Beginners

Starting your investment journey can feel overwhelming, but exploring passive income offers a compelling path to financial stability. Dividend stocks have long been a popular choice for building steady cash flow. As a beginner, it's crucial to identify dividend-paying companies with a history of solid performance and a commitment to shareholder value.

  • Analyze companies in sectors you understand, such as consumer staples or utilities, known for their resilience.
  • Consider a company's dividend payout ratio, ensuring it remains sustainable over time.
  • Balance your portfolio across multiple companies to mitigate risk and maximize potential returns.

Remember, investing involves risk, so it's important to conduct thorough research, understand your level for risk, and consult with a financial advisor if needed. By carefully selecting dividend stocks and building a well-diversified portfolio, you can set yourself on the path to achieving your dreams.

Creating Wealth Step by Step: Your Starter Portfolio

Embarking on your wealth-building journey can feel overwhelming. Yet, it doesn't have to be! Start with a solid base and gradually increase your portfolio. One of the greatest ways is through a well-structured starter portfolio that suits your investment style.

  • First, determine your financial goals. What are you investing for? Retirement? A down payment on a home? Once you have clarity on your desires, you can opt for investments that align with your time horizon.
  • Following this, diversify your portfolio across different asset classes. This reduces risk by not putting all your eggs in one stock. Consider a mix of equities, fixed-income securities, and property.
  • Finally, remember to review your portfolio regularly. The market is continuously, so modifying your investments as needed will help you stay on course towards your investment goals.
